Abstract
The present invention proposes a kind of new-energy automobile charging system, some new-energy automobile charging stations including being arranged at diverse location, the central server being connected with the new-energy automobile charging station, the central server is connected with the car running computer of new-energy automobile, the car running computer real-time detection automobile dump energy, determine the mileage of dump energy, according to the mileage of dump energy, find the new-energy automobile charging station in mileage, and when dump energy is less than threshold values, warning reminding is carried out to car owner using the car running computer, the present invention can plan charging scheme according to the real time status of car owner, ensure the even running of automobile, car owner will not be influenceed to experience because of electrical problems.

Technical field
The invention belongs to new-energy automobile charging technique field, more particularly to a kind of new-energy automobile charging system.
Background technology
At present, pure electric automobile has the advantages that low operating cost, zero-emission, noise is low, can make full use of trough electricity, can
Ridden instead of walk with meeting user's working, the trip primary demand such as outgoing workings, amusement and recreation, it is deep by the automobile-used family expectation of vast purchase.But
Pure electric automobile success popularization and application must solve user and also there are misgivings:Continual mileage is short, at any time may be because of depleted of energy
Parking, this is the maximum worry of user;Charge not convenient, charging pile, charging station infrastructure that current pure electric automobile is used
There is no fully under way, presumable place is " having car without electricity ", even if there is electrically-charging equipment, charge at any time for user brings fiber crops yet
It is tired;Because automobile cannot normally run caused by new energy car owner cannot charge in time, so that car owner's driving experience is influenceed,
New-energy automobile development is largely limited.
Therefore, need a kind of new-energy automobile charging system badly now, charging side can be planned according to the real time status of car owner
Case, it is ensured that the even running of automobile, will not influence car owner to experience because of electrical problems.
The content of the invention
The present invention proposes a kind of new-energy automobile charging system, solves in the prior art because new energy car owner cannot
Automobile cannot normally run caused by charging in time, so as to influence the problem of car owner's driving experience.
The technical proposal of the invention is realized in this way:New-energy automobile charging system, including it is arranged at diverse location
Some new-energy automobile charging stations, the central server being connected with the new-energy automobile charging station, the central server connects
The car running computer of new-energy automobile is connected to, the car running computer real-time detection automobile dump energy determines the driving of dump energy
Mileage, according to the mileage of dump energy, finds the new-energy automobile charging station in mileage, and when dump energy is small
When threshold values, warning reminding is carried out to car owner using the car running computer.
Preferred embodiment determine the mileage of dump energy as a kind of, including according to automobile duration section
Interior road speed and parking frequency, determines running car environment, according to the running car environment, determines dump energy
Highest mileage.
As one kind preferred embodiment, the running car environment includes urban drive environment and ring of at the uniform velocity driving a vehicle
Border, user actively selects environment, or utilizes PUSH message prophet's car owner's environment.
As one kind preferred embodiment, the new-energy automobile charging station in mileage is found, using described
Central server generates new-energy automobile charging station electronic coordinate map, and according to the mileage of the determination dump energy
A planning at least charging route plan, and the charging route plan is shown in electronic coordinate map.
As one kind preferred embodiment, the charging route side that the mileage according to the determination dump energy is planned
Case, its dump energy that particular factor is should be less than by the electricity that car owner position arrival charging station is consumed.
As one kind preferred embodiment, the particular factor is 0.8.
As one kind preferred embodiment, when planning charging route plan using the central server, with reference to driving
The route plan institute in the maximum electricity that the route plan is consumed in date, and continuous time section, and continuous time section
The maximum electricity of consumption is less than or equal to automobile dump energy.
As it is a kind of preferred embodiment, it is determined that during charging route plan, using described server real-time monitoring road
The traffic of line scheme, and real-time traffic condition is pushed into car owner's user terminal.
Real-time traffic condition is preferred embodiment pushed into car owner's user terminal as a kind of, it is aobvious using different colours
Show the traffic in the section that the route plan includes.
As one kind preferred embodiment, when automobile dump energy is less than threshold value, including when automobile dump energy is less than
During the first threshold values, the first prompting is carried out to car owner;When automobile dump energy is less than the second threshold values, car owner is carried out second
Remind.
